Series: Beadle's Weekly — v. 3 no. 118
Contents: Kissing on the Sly (Work, page 1)
The Jew Detective; or, The Beautiful Convict (Work, chapters I-IV, pages 1-2)
Fire Feather, the Buccaneer King. A Tale of the Caribbean Sea (Work, chapters XVIII-XXII, pages 2-3)
Stonewall Bob, The Boy Trojan of the Great Range; or, The Search for the Hidden Cache (Work, chapters XIV-XV (conclusion), page 3)
Girl Who Smoke Cigarettes (Work, page 4)
How the Cattle Suffer (Work, page 4)
Yankee Courtship (Work, page 5)
Poor-House Pete, The Postal-Clerk Detective; or The Secrets of Fisher Farm (Work, chapters I-III, page 5)
A Dead Man's Story (Work, pages 5-6)
The Newsboy (Work, page 6)
Fire Face, the Silver King's Foe; or, The Mysterious Highwayman. A Tale of Colorado (Work, chapters XV-XVII, page 6)
My Recompense (Work, page 7)
Monte Cristo Afloat; or, The Wandering Jew of the Sea (Work, chapters XL-XLII, page 7)
An Outlaw's Wife (Work, page 7)
Big Injun Over The Rhine (Work, page 8)
A Change of Base (Work, page 8)
A Snow-Drift (Work, page 8)
Tough Tom (Work, page 8)
Heroes and Outlaws of Texas: The Knights of the Golden Circle (Work, page 8)
Date: February 14, 1885
Publisher: Beadle and Adams (1872-1898) (New York (N.Y.)) -- United States
Edition Description: Also includes: The Wide Awake Papers (department), Happy-Go-Lucky Papers (department), Focused Facts (department), Correspondents' Column (department), Science and Industry (department), Casual Mention (department), Telephone Echoes (department), and filler. There are a few short articles including: Oddities of Town Names, The Coming Comet, and Odd Facts from Mexico, in addition to untitled short articles.
Length: 8 pages
